A square sign has an area of approximately 158 feet .What is the approximate length of one side of the sign?

Answer:

12.5698 (approximately 12.5, rounding to the nearest half)

Step-by-step explanation:

The area of a square is represented by the following equation:

[tex]A=a^2[/tex]

Whereas "a" represents the length of any one of the sides.

Since all sides of a square are equal in length, we can reverse engineer this formula to find the length of one side.

[tex]158=a^2[/tex]

Simply take the square root of both sides and you will have your answer.

[tex]12.5698=a[/tex]
